> On Sun, 25 Jun 2006, Thomas Bruederli wrote:
>> The Google spell checker isn't accessible over port 80 but only over
>> HTTPS. I altered the file program/steps/mail/spell.inc (see revision
>> 256) accordingly. Unfortunately the spell checker now only works on
>> servers having Open SSL included with PHP.

Here's the changelog, looks like was some changes to googiespell.js too

http://orangoo.com/labs/?page_id=45

Version 3.78 - 16. Juni 2006
- Google has switched to SSL. HTTPS instead of HTTP

So this might be the time I start looking at aspell integrations, since this 
will effectively close off most RC implementations. Anyone started on this 
yet/have any clues?
